Double-weighted statement

Cathy Come Home is the only full-length account of a television play that has been of considerable political and cultural importance. It was based on the collection and analysis of extensive primary sources, including the BBC Written Archives, and interviews with some of the main programme makers (e.g. Tony Garnett). It also involved synthesising different kinds of research materials, including government policy documents, BBC memoranda and personal archives (e.g. Jeremy Sandford), some of which were difficult to access. This project is the culmination of a decade’s research on social realist television drama of the 1960s and 70s.
